HomeMy WebLinkAbout041922-06.4 ADMINISTRATIVE STAFF REPORT 6.4 TO: Mayor and Town Council April 19, 2022 SUBJECT: Resolution No. 30-2022, receiving and accepting the Housing Element Annual Progress Report for 2021 BACKGROUND The State of California requires that all local governments adequately plan to meet local housing needs through adoption of a General Plan Housing Element that includes policies, programs, and quantified objectives to guide decisions related to the development of housing. State law also mandates that each city prepare an Annual Progress Report (APR) on the implementation of its Housing Element in a format prescribed by the California Department of Housing and Community Development (HCD). The report is then used to monitor the city’s progress toward accommodating its “fair share” assignment of the region’s housing needs for specific affordability levels. California Government Code Section 65400 requires that the local legislative body review and accept the APR (Attachment B), which is then submitted to HCD and the Governor’s Office of Planning and Research (OPR). DISCUSSION The Danville 2014-2022 Housing Element covers the eight-year period from January 2015 to January 2023. The attached report covers the first seven years of that period, reporting housing activity from 2015 through 2021. The format prescribed for APRs by HCD, beginning with the 2018 report, requires housing unit production be reported in three categories: (a) potential housing units that have secured all requisite planning entitlements but have not yet initiated the building permit process as of the end of the APR reporting year; (b) potential housing units that have initiated the building permit process and were somewhere between a building permit status of “Applied” to a status of “Under Construction,” but had not secured a final building inspection release as of the end of the APR reporting year; and (c) units that secured final building inspection release in the prior calendar year as of the APR reporting year. Income Categories Danville’s assigned “fair share” of the region’s housing need is determined by the Association of Bay Area Governments (ABAG). For the current planning period, the assignment is 557 total units comprised of four affordability categories. Housing Element Annual 2 April 19, 2022 Progress Report for 2021 Each category is defined by the state of California and expressed as a percent of the most recently published area median income, as follows: •Very low income (50% or below of area median income):196 units •Low income (51-80% of area median income):111 units •Moderate income (81-120% of area median income):124 units •Above moderate income (>120% of area median income):126 units Total Assigned Units - Danville: 557 units The published area median income for 2021 applicable to Danville is outlined below and further differentiated by household size: 1-Person Household 2-Person Household 3-Person Household 4-Person Household 5-Person Household Very low income $47,950 $54,800 $61,650 $68,500 $74,000 Low income $76,750 $87,700 $98,650 $109,600 $118,400 Median income $87,900 $100,500 $113,050 $125,600 $135,650 Moderate income $105,500 $120,550 $135,650 $150,700 $162,750 These income categories are based on the United States Department of Housing and Urban Development’s (HUD) income categories. It is important to note that state law does not require cities to build housing. The development of housing is driven by private market forces. The Town’s obligation is to provide an appropriate amount of land, with the proper general plan land use designation and the appropriate zoning designation, to accommodate the private development of housing units for the assigned quantity and affordability levels.
